Common Causes of your Concrete Problems in Ironton
Noticing uneven floors or cracks in your driveway? These common issues around Ironton often stem from changes in soil and water interaction beneath your home's surfaces. The region's seasonal moisture swings can lead to significant soil movement. Soil in this area can expand with moisture during rainy periods and contract during drier spells, a process known locally as soil heave. Combine this with Ironton's clay-rich terrain, and you have the perfect conditions for your concrete surfaces to shift, settle, or crack over time.
This persistent movement can place stress on your home's foundation and other concrete components, causing noticeable problems like sticking doors, cracks in walls, or water pooling around your property. Foam lifting is often an ideal solution for sunken concrete if the concrete slabs are still in good condition but have settled due to soil erosion, poor compaction, or water issues. It is suitable for driveways, sidewalks, patios, and many other types of concrete surfaces. An evaluation by a concrete lifting professional can confirm if foam lifting is the proper solution for your situation.
While some cracks in concrete may be purely cosmetic, others can indicate serious structural problems. Hairline cracks may not be immediately concerning but wider, deeper, or growing cracks could signify underlying issues like settling, soil erosion, or excessive loads. It's advisable to have a professional evaluate your concrete to determine the severity and appropriate course of action.
Performing foam lifting in certain seasons may offer benefits such as better temperature conditions for the expansion and curing of the foam. However, foam lifting can typically be done year-round unless the weather is extreme, like in the case of heavy snow or extreme cold. Consulting with a local professional can provide specific insights on optimal timing based on Ironton's climate.
Concrete lifting can help realign and stabilize the existing concrete surface, and if the conditions causing the initial sinking or cracking (like poor drainage or soil settlement) are addressed, it can significantly reduce the likelihood of future issues. However, lifting alone won't completely prevent future problems if external conditions change or further erosion occurs. Regular maintenance and monitoring are recommended.
